`
kimmking
  • 浏览: 546661 次
  • 性别: Icon_minigender_1
  • 来自: 中华大丈夫学院
社区版块
存档分类
最新评论

excelpanel--extjs中嵌入excel,并封装简单操作

    博客分类:
  • ext
阅读更多

ExcelPanel

Kimmking

kimmking@163.com

 

这个东西,是我1年半前的一个项目里用过的。很久以前整理了下,一直没有好好折腾出来,放在那里竟然一直没工夫好好完善了,杯具啊,时间都拿来聊天灌水了。

前不久一个网友要用,我就翻出来,看看,基本可用。以后再完善和出文档吧。

基础的功能已经有了,有人感兴趣的话,可以讨论下。

 

 新建一个excel:

http://dl.iteye.com/upload/picture/pic/52478/77326660-40e7-3ee9-bd0b-66f95637fbb3.jpg 

 打开一个excel文件:

http://dl.iteye.com/upload/picture/pic/52476/87d784bb-4858-3f7b-b173-e97a64a1c9e8.jpg 

另存excel文件:

http://dl.iteye.com/upload/picture/pic/52474/595897a9-6fd4-3854-9f68-bcaed44874cb.jpg 

放大:

http://dl.iteye.com/upload/picture/pic/52472/0ca88338-0688-3c24-a198-9d636a6adde9.jpg 

缩小:

http://dl.iteye.com/upload/picture/pic/52470/e77ba545-906c-3c37-918e-912e9a48267e.jpg 

打印预览:

http://dl.iteye.com/upload/picture/pic/52480/a5965bf5-2a5a-35d9-8bea-d11e040cc3f3.jpg 

js获取excel单元格内容:

http://dl.iteye.com/upload/picture/pic/52482/08126eb5-3aac-3664-ba73-c6de86bae934.jpg 

分享到:
评论
20 楼 icyhoo2063 2014-10-10  
你的dsoframer是2.0版的,不知道是谁二次开发弄出来的,微软1.3版的是有数字签名的,比这个靠谱
19 楼 kimmking 2012-08-23  
J.Anc 写道
alert( "创建新Excel出错."  + e.description); 一直报这个错误


降低ie的安全性
18 楼 J.Anc 2012-08-22  
alert( "创建新Excel出错."  + e.description); 一直报这个错误
17 楼 lzy83925 2010-11-29  
这个太强大了
16 楼 dreampuf01 2010-08-03  
...话说...word....的....
15 楼 waggie 2010-08-02  
请问如何实现动态的excel文件载入。
我想把这个做成录入界面。excel内容从数据库取出。用户完成后再填回数据库。
14 楼 七月十五 2010-03-07  
基于ActiveX实现的Excel还算是ExtJS的功劳么?
13 楼 kimmking 2010-03-05  
kaleido 写道
今天看到你的exreport,很有兴趣,可能会使用

好的,可以联系我。
12 楼 kaleido 2010-03-05  
今天看到你的exreport,很有兴趣,可能会使用
11 楼 kimmking 2010-01-12  
http://code.google.com/p/qsoft/downloads/list
MS_DSOFramer_OpenSource_V2.2.1.2.zip  MS_DSOFramer_OpenSource_V2.2.1.2 

源码和示例下载
10 楼 deyami 2010-01-12  
我对你那个dsoframer.ocx控件比较感兴趣。

这东西是怎么来的?
9 楼 kimmking 2010-01-12  
支持所有excel功能,
都可以直接使用js调用。
8 楼 dayang2001911 2010-01-12  
能否支持有合并单元格的EXCEL的展示呢?
7 楼 kimmking 2010-01-10  
letsflytogether 写道
activex 能不能开源?

这个activex本来就是微软开源出来的,
网上的一些人改了一些,就是我现在用的2.x的版本。

都可以在网上找源码,要的也没有pm我。
6 楼 letsflytogether 2010-01-10  
activex 能不能开源?
5 楼 kimmking 2010-01-10  
kimmking 写道
southgate 写道
可以在FF下用吗

不可以,基于activex

也不是没办法,不过windows+ office少不了

ff可以使用
http://board.mozest.com/viewthread.php?tid=2350

http://code.google.com/p/ff-activex-host/
支持activex
官方也有一个不太好用的扩展
4 楼 kimmking 2010-01-10  
southgate 写道
可以在FF下用吗

不可以,基于activex
3 楼 southgate 2010-01-10  
可以在FF下用吗
2 楼 kimmking 2010-01-09  
lw223 写道
最近爱上了金山的wps。

可以嵌入吗?
1 楼 lw223 2010-01-08  
最近爱上了金山的wps。

相关推荐

    extjs2----关于extjs 的使用,操作

    总之,通过学习这个教程,初学者可以掌握ExtJS 2.0的基本操作,建立起对组件化开发的理解,并能动手构建简单的Web应用。虽然版本相对较旧,但理解基础原理对于升级到更高版本或是学习其他前端框架都非常有帮助。随着...

    基于EXTJS 的在线EXCEL编辑器

    总之,基于EXTJS的在线EXCEL编辑器是一种高效且便捷的数据处理工具,结合了EXTJS的组件化和Web技术的优势,为用户提供了灵活的在线Excel操作体验。对于开发者来说,这是一个深入理解EXTJS框架和Web应用开发的好机会...

    EXTJS grid导出EXCEL文件

    EXTJS是一个基于JavaScript的...以上就是EXTJS Grid导出Excel文件的相关知识点,理解并掌握这些内容可以帮助你实现从EXTJS应用中导出数据到Excel的功能。在实际开发中,还需要考虑性能优化、错误处理以及兼容性问题。

    eslint-plugin-extjs:使用ExtJS框架的项目的ESLint规则

    eslint-plugin-extjs 使用ExtJS框架的项目的ESLint规则。 这些规则的目标是与ExtJS 4.x一起使用。 欢迎请求与5.x兼容的请求! 规则明细 ext-array-foreach ExtJS提供的两个主要的数组迭代器函数和不同之处在于, ...

    extjs模拟excel表格

    在本文中,我们将深入探讨如何使用ExtJS来模拟Excel表格,以及实现Excel的各种功能。 首先,ExtJS中的GridPanel组件是实现模拟Excel表格的核心。GridPanel允许我们展示大量数据,并提供了诸如排序、过滤、分页等...

    struts2-hibernate-spring-Extjs-json.rar_JSON_extjs_extjs json st

    综上所述,这个压缩包提供的资料可能涵盖了如何在Struts2中配置和使用Hibernate进行数据持久化,如何利用Spring进行依赖管理和数据访问,以及如何结合ExtJS创建富客户端界面并利用JSON进行前后端通信。对于想要深入...

    EXTJS4导出excel示例

    以下是一个简单的EXTJS4导出Excel的代码示例: ```javascript // 假设你已经有了一个名为grid的GridPanel实例,其store为store实例 var csvData = ''; store.each(function(record) { var fields = record.data; ...

    extjs-OA extjs-oa

    一个extjs的OA项目 extjs-OA extjs-oaextjs-OA extjs-oa

    ExtJS grid过滤操作

    ExtJS Grid是一个强大的数据展示组件,它允许用户以表格的形式查看和操作大量数据。在实际应用中,数据过滤是常见的需求,以便用户能快速定位到感兴趣的信息。本篇将深入探讨ExtJS Grid的过滤操作,以及如何动态地对...

    extjs grid数据导出excel文件

    总结来说,EXTJS Grid的数据导出到Excel是通过获取Grid数据、转换数据格式、利用SheetJS创建Excel文件,并最终提供下载链接来实现的。这一过程涉及到了EXTJS的Store操作、SheetJS的API使用以及前端文件操作等技术。...

    extjs gridToExcel

    这是一个简单的在extjs下的grid转化到Excel,里面代码简单易懂,在包里面还集成了复杂的js转化函数,不过本人没有用它来进行转化! 注:在用EXTJS的导出Excel技术中,一定要注意分页的问题

    ExtJS实现Excel导出

    #### 极致解析:ExtJS中的Excel导出机制 **1. 概念理解** ExtJS是一种基于客户端的AJAX应用框架,它不仅提供了丰富的UI组件库,还支持与后端服务无缝集成。对于许多项目而言,将数据导出为Excel文件是一个常见的...

    extjs4导出excel

    "extjs4导出excel"的功能就是实现了这个需求,让用户能够在ExtJS 4应用中方便地导出表格数据到Excel文件。 在ExtJS 4中实现数据导出至Excel通常涉及以下几个关键步骤: 1. **数据收集**:首先,你需要收集要导出的...

    ExtJS拖拽导入Excel数据

    用户可以从excel中选中要导入的数据,直接拖拽到grid中

    ExtJS4中文教程2 开发笔记 chm

    ExtJS 4中动态加载的路径设置 Extjs4 API文档阅读(一)——类系统(Class System) Extjs4 API文档阅读(三)——布局和容器 Extjs4 API文档阅读(二)——MVC构架(上) Extjs4 API文档阅读(二)——MVC构架(下) Extjs4...

    Extjs6.2 生成的admin-dashboard官方模板

    Extjs6.2 生成的admin-dashboard官方模板

    extjs中嵌入ckeditor完整实例

    extjs中嵌入ckeditor的完整实例,同时有ckeditor的配置说明

    extjs 嵌入 ckeditor 例子

    在ExtJS中,我们可以创建一个自定义组件来封装CKEditor。首先定义一个ExtJS的`Ext.Component`,并使用CKEditor的API来初始化编辑器实例。例如: ```javascript Ext.define('MyApp.ckeditor.CKEditor', { extend: '...

    Extjs4.0学习笔记

    xtjs4,创建Ext组件有了新的方式,就是Ext.create(....),而且可以使用动态加载JS的方式来加快组件的渲染,我们再也不必一次加载已经达到1MB的ext-all.js了,本文介绍如何在EXTJS4中创建一个window。 共:10 小节, ...

    spket-1.6.23 ,ExtJs开发插件

    从中解压出features与plugins文件夹,复制到E:\MyEclipse\myPlugins\spket-1.6.23里面 在E:\MyEclipse\MyEclipse 10\dropins下新建文件spket-1.6.23 .link,内容是:path=E:\\MyEclipse\\myPlugins\\spket-1.6.23 保存...

Global site tag (gtag.js) - Google Analytics